Honest by construction: confirmed defects and suspected ones are kept separate. --- # Dream beta-test Beta-test the **consolidate-memory "dream" skill** in a target repo and emit one structured, version-stamped report. You are the dream skill's **consumer / beta-tester** — you run it faithfully, instrument it, and report defects. **You never patch the dream skill** (nothing under its plugin dir); this tooling ships as the `dream-beta-tester` plugin — its scripts live under `$CLAUDE_PLUGIN_ROOT/scripts/` and you run them from there. The harness has two detectors and your job is to run **both**: 1. a **deterministic invariant oracle** (already built: `beta_checks.py`, driven by `run_beta.py`) that re-tests known defect **families** every run — the trustworthy floor; 2. the **judgment lenses** (this skill's contribution) that you apply by hand to *this* run's actual artifacts to catch **novel** defects the families don't encode — the dynamic half. Two properties make this worth doing, and everything below serves them: - **Dynamic, not overfit** — adapt to whatever *this* run surfaces; never just re-run a frozen checklist. The oracle re-tests known classes; the lenses find new ones. - **Honest** — a confident-wrong defect is worse than a missed one. The harness has already retracted two of its own hand-diagnoses, so **every finding is re-verified against source before it is called confirmed**, and suspected ones are quarantined, never counted. ## Flow ### 1 · Run the deterministic engine ``` python3 "$CLAUDE_PLUGIN_ROOT/scripts/run_beta.py" --repo <TARGET_REPO> --test --json ``` `--test` (default) restores the store afterward — a pure beta-test that leaves no mutation; default repo is cwd. The runner snapshots the store, runs the oracle (which drives the dream skill's **own read-only scripts** from a clean subprocess pinned to the target repo), renders a report to `reports/<slug>__<version>__<ts>.md`, diffs the store, and restores. Note the **consolidate-memory version under test** (stamped in the report header) and the report path. Read the rendered report. ### 2 · Confirm the oracle's findings — promote or downgrade Oracle WARN/FAIL findings land in the report's **§2a-FLAGGED** (oracle-flagged, unconfirmed). For each, open the **live** skill output it refers to and either: - **promote → §2a-VERIFIED**, quoting the exact contradicting line from the real `memory_status.py` / `render_dashboard.py` output; or - **downgrade**, if you cannot reproduce it. The oracle is a hypothesis too — re-firing a defect the skill has already FIXED is itself a harness bug, and saying so is the job. ### 3 · Apply the judgment lenses — the dynamic half Read `references/lenses.md` and apply each lens to *this* run's artifacts (the rendered dream dashboard + the oracle JSON + the live store). The lenses are constant; the findings are per-run. They exist to catch what the deterministic families don't: a novel inconsistency, a dishonest claim, an incoherent recommendation, an unsafe suggestion. ### 4 · Reduce every judgment finding before cataloging it A lens finding is a **suspicion, not a defect.** Quarantine it in **§2b (judgment-flagged, UNVERIFIED)** until it reduces to one of: - (a) a **reproducible deterministic check** — you can show the exact command + its output; or - (b) a **quoted source-contradiction** — you quote the skill's own output contradicting itself or reality. Only then promote it to **§2a-VERIFIED**. Whatever you cannot reduce stays in §2b, shipped explicitly as an unverified hypothesis for human triage — **never counted as a defect.** This single discipline is the skill's whole value; it is what keeps the catalog trustworthy. ### 5 · Write the findings in + present Augment the rendered report: fill §2a-VERIFIED (confirmed, with quotes) and §2b (unverified hypotheses). A **clean run is a clean report** — empty findings is a valid, good outcome; do not invent defects to fill space. Present the report path + a tight summary: *version under test · N confirmed · N unverified · the run-delta vs the prior report for this repo*. ### 6 · (Optional) Crystallize a confirmed novel class into a family If you confirmed a **novel, general** defect class (not an existing family, not a one-off), you may add it to `$CLAUDE_PLUGIN_ROOT/scripts/beta_checks.py` as a new `(Ctx) -> [Result]` family so every future run re-tests it deterministically — the harness gets smarter each run. Tie its PASS to the FIXED behavior so a real regression flips it. This is the only code you write, and only for the harness — never the dream skill. ## Hard rules - **Never patch the consolidate-memory skill.** You are its consumer/tester; surface defects in the report and let its author patch them. Writing into its plugin dir is out of scope. - **Any-repo.** Derive the slug; run the skill's scripts from `cwd = target repo` via a clean subprocess (the contamination root cause the harness exists to catch). `run_beta.py` already does this — if you run a skill script by hand, pass the target repo **positionally**. - **Reports** live under `~/.dream-beta-test/reports/` (a stable user dir, so they survive plugin updates and the orchestrator has a fixed `latest.json` path). Never write into the skill's dir. - This skill is the **tester**. A plain "dream / consolidate / checkpoint my memory" request is the skill **under test** — use `consolidate-memory`, not this. ## Depth The authoritative design is `$CLAUDE_PLUGIN_ROOT/docs/SPEC.md` (§4 detection · §5 flow · §6 report · §7 snapshot · §8 versioning). Read it when you need the *why* behind a step.
